3v4l.org

run code in 300+ PHP versions simultaneously
<?php $internal_functions = get_defined_functions()['internal']; $lengths = array_map( function ($name) { return strlen($name); }, $internal_functions ); $length_variance = array_count_values($lengths); ksort($length_variance); echo 'Total Function Count: '. count($length_variance) . PHP_EOL . PHP_EOL; foreach ($length_variance as $length => $count) { echo 'Name Length: '. $length; echo "\t\t Count:". $count; echo PHP_EOL; }
Output for git.master, git.master_jit
Total Function Count: 36 Name Length: 2 Count:2 Name Length: 3 Count:16 Name Length: 4 Count:31 Name Length: 5 Count:55 Name Length: 6 Count:68 Name Length: 7 Count:73 Name Length: 8 Count:47 Name Length: 9 Count:72 Name Length: 10 Count:65 Name Length: 11 Count:78 Name Length: 12 Count:70 Name Length: 13 Count:74 Name Length: 14 Count:52 Name Length: 15 Count:48 Name Length: 16 Count:43 Name Length: 17 Count:42 Name Length: 18 Count:44 Name Length: 19 Count:35 Name Length: 20 Count:43 Name Length: 21 Count:56 Name Length: 22 Count:25 Name Length: 23 Count:38 Name Length: 24 Count:19 Name Length: 25 Count:27 Name Length: 26 Count:19 Name Length: 27 Count:15 Name Length: 28 Count:9 Name Length: 29 Count:8 Name Length: 30 Count:2 Name Length: 32 Count:6 Name Length: 33 Count:3 Name Length: 34 Count:1 Name Length: 35 Count:1 Name Length: 36 Count:4 Name Length: 37 Count:4 Name Length: 38 Count:4
Output for rfc.property-hooks
Total Function Count: 36 Name Length: 2 Count:2 Name Length: 3 Count:16 Name Length: 4 Count:31 Name Length: 5 Count:55 Name Length: 6 Count:68 Name Length: 7 Count:73 Name Length: 8 Count:47 Name Length: 9 Count:72 Name Length: 10 Count:65 Name Length: 11 Count:78 Name Length: 12 Count:70 Name Length: 13 Count:76 Name Length: 14 Count:52 Name Length: 15 Count:48 Name Length: 16 Count:43 Name Length: 17 Count:42 Name Length: 18 Count:44 Name Length: 19 Count:35 Name Length: 20 Count:43 Name Length: 21 Count:56 Name Length: 22 Count:25 Name Length: 23 Count:38 Name Length: 24 Count:19 Name Length: 25 Count:27 Name Length: 26 Count:19 Name Length: 27 Count:15 Name Length: 28 Count:9 Name Length: 29 Count:8 Name Length: 30 Count:2 Name Length: 32 Count:6 Name Length: 33 Count:3 Name Length: 34 Count:1 Name Length: 35 Count:1 Name Length: 36 Count:4 Name Length: 37 Count:4 Name Length: 38 Count:4

This tab shows result from various feature-branches currently under review by the php developers. Contact me to have additional branches featured.

Active branches

Archived branches

Once feature-branches are merged or declined, they are no longer available. Their functionality (when merged) can be viewed from the main output page


preferences:
41.82 ms | 402 KiB | 8 Q